President Donald Trump has granted pardons to the three co-founders of the prominent crypto exchange, BitMEX, and a fourth high-ranking employee. The pro-crypto president granted pardon to BitMEX co-founders Arthur Hayes, Benjamin Delo, and Samuel Reed alongside Gregory Dwyer, the former head of business development, media outlet CNBC reported.
